Real-World Examples

Case Study 1: High-Performance Gaming PC

CPU: 120W, GPU: 300W, RAM: 15W, Storage: 8W, Display: 60W

Total Power Consumption: 403W

Case Study 2: Mid-Range Workstation

CPU: 95W, GPU: 200W, RAM: 12W, Storage: 8W, Display: 50W

Total Power Consumption: 365W

Case Study 3: Energy-Efficient Laptop

CPU: 15W, GPU: 30W, RAM: 6W, Storage: 5W, Display: 30W

Total Power Consumption: 86W

Data & Statistics

Average Power Consumption of Computer Components
Component Average Power (Watts)
CPU 95W
GPU 150W
RAM 10W
Storage 8W
Display 60W
Power Consumption of Different Computer Types
Computer Type Average Power Consumption (Watts)
Desktop 250W
Laptop 65W
Server 200W

Expert Tips

  • Monitor your computer’s power consumption to identify power-hungry components and optimize their performance.
  • Consider upgrading to energy-efficient components to reduce your computer’s power consumption.
  • Enable power-saving modes and features in your operating system to reduce idle power consumption.
  • Keep your computer clean and well-ventilated to ensure optimal performance and reduce power consumption.

How can I measure my computer’s power consumption?

You can use a power meter or a Kill A Watt device to measure your computer’s power consumption in watts.

What factors affect my computer’s power consumption?

Component power, usage patterns, and environmental factors all contribute to your computer’s power consumption.
